DRO: Where the Pavement Ends – Metallic crab salad and crushed toes in Bakersfield
“But through all of that, the biggest story was the turnout: Yes, in a scene reminiscent of a Steinbeck novel or a dusty Henry Fonda movie, hordes of racers and race fans fired up their rust-buckets, rail-jobs and stripped-down coupes, took to the highway and made the migration to Bakersfield and its drag strip out by the oil fields, Famoso Raceway. More than 500 race cars entered. Twenty-nine Funny Cars slugged it for eight slots on the Elimination ladder. On Saturday morning, it took an hour to crawl five miles from the exit off of Highway 99 to the track’s parking lots and entrances. Bill Groak, the event’s publicist, marveled, “What recession?” in reference to the legions of go-cat-wild gearheads that overran the facility.”

TOP FUEL WORMHOLE DELIVERY DATE
Top Fuel Wormhole, a feature-length book of motorsport-themed essays and articles subtitled The Cole Coonce Drag Strip Reader,Vol. 1, is on the galleys and almost off to the printer.
Coming in at nearly 300 pages, this anthology is comprised of work that first ran a plehtora of drag racing, automotive and pop culture magazines and websites, including Full Throttle News, Super Stock & Drag Illustrated, Bikini, Grand Royal, Gearhead, Nitronic Research and others.
Despite the fervent efforts of its imprint, KeroseneBomb Publishing, hopes of having copies of the book in hand this week for distribution at the upcoming March Meet are remote, however. A more like release date is March 21st, 2009.
Since the March Meet publication deadline wil be missed, we thought it would be ono to offer up a tasty sample of the book in the online form, ith the uploading of the book’s cover story, “THE CHAMPION SPEED SHOP’S TOP FUEL WORMHOLE: A Concentric History of the World’s Quickest and Fastest Chevy on Nitro…”
The story’s illustration is this pic of the Champion Speed Shop fueler, taken ten years ago at the starting of Famoso Raceway.

DRO: “The Day of the Deluge, and Survival of the Unfittest”
The new “Where The Pavement Ends” column is up on Drag Racing Online: “The Day of the Deluge, and Survival of the Unfittest.”
If the Winternationals at Pomona are any indication, drag racing is in a world of hurt….
An excerpt of the piece: “Is it just the economy and the weather? Or is part of the problem that those nitromaniacs who once lived for Top Fuel have found less and less to relate to? In the interest of safety when it comes to Top Fuel dragsters and Funny Cars, there has been a neutering of nitro percentages the last few years and now an emasculation of the distance of the drag strip from 1/4 mile to 1000 feet.”
